Have people found one (Hotwire or Priceline) to be preferable over the other? Is there a major difference in bidding?Thanks for your help!
Romelle Posted November 19, 2012 Report Posted November 19, 2012 There isn't any bidding on HOTWIRE. You just accept the listed price. HOTWIRE allows one to select for specific amenities - free parking, airport shuttle, whatever ?? The positive reviews % is usually noted. Also, the experts here can provide an educated guess as to what the hotel might be - before purchase. Priceline can be a little less expensive. The zones for PRICELINE and HOTWIRE have different boundaries. There is the fact that Hotwire can be more generous with stars - the half star difference you mention. But I've seen examples of a full star difference, AND examples of no difference.The hotels offered can be different, with one hotel only showing up via PRICELINE and another only showing up via HOTWIRE. For examples of the different South Beach hotels in the two, you can browse the hotel lists at the very beginning of the Priceline -Florida and Hotwire - Florida areas. Romelle
